For the latest news from in and around Oldham sign up to the MyOldham newsletter here A young mum with a history of self-harm was found dead at her home in Oldham during last summer's lockdown, an inquest heard.

Laura Hoy, 28, had struggled with depression since her late teens and had taken several 'impulsive overdoses' in the past. In the months before her death on July 10 last year Ms Hoy and her fiancéBen Wright had been having relationship problems, which, alongside the lockdown, may have exacerbated how she was feeling, the inquest heard.

Mr Wright found the body of Ms Hoy, who had a young daughter, in the spare room of their home in Royton after she took her own life.
